Can ADHD co-occur with PDD-NOS? |
I'm 23 and I have ADHD and was just diagnosed with PDD-NOS a few days ago. I was diagnosed with ADHD and a comprehension learning disability back in 1992 or 1993 when i was 8 or 9. I had and still have poor gross and fine motor skills. I was also diagnosed with depression and GAD when I was 18 or 19. For a while now, I've been researching alot about AS and other neurological problems that can co-morbid with AS. I was for sure that I had AS, but a few days ago, i was diagnosed with PDD-NOS and not AS. How come it takes so long to diagnose PDD-NOS and Asperger's Syndrome in girls? And can ADHD co-occur along with PDD-NOS, just like it can co-occur along with AS? Yes. I was in spec ed as an assistant teacher for over 20 years. Ausperger's syndrome which as you know is part of the whole PDD umbrella, can occur separately or together w/any other disorder. I had students w/ADHD, psychosis, bi-polar disorder, ausperger's, etc. Any combination of these. Usually autism, auspergers syndrome, etc. occur w/higher frequency in males. When it does occur in females, unfortunately they are often disdiagnosed initially w/other illnesses. Also in females, believe it or not, the disorders are usually more life altering than in males. Perhaps this is due to the later diagnosis, the fact that females are usually more emotional than males due to our genetic makeup, etc. I think it is wonderful that you are able to do this research, are interested in seeing just what your disorder is, how to best work within any limitations it may have on you and that you ask questions to learn more.
